Why AWS Database Access Security Runbooks Matter

Even the best IAM policies break down without clear steps to follow. An AWS database security runbook removes guesswork by defining the exact process for granting, reviewing, and revoking access. It ensures every change is intentional, reviewed, and logged. It turns “Who has access?” from an open question into a simple checklist.

Threats rarely wait for a ticket to be approved. A detailed runbook means anyone with the right role can execute secure actions without scrambling for help. This isn’t only for responding to incidents — it’s for daily governance, compliance audits, and even onboarding.

Core Elements of a Strong AWS Database Access Security Runbook

  1. Access Request Workflow: Define how requests are submitted, approved, and documented. Use standard templates so the right details are always captured.
  2. IAM Role Governance: Map specific database access levels to AWS IAM roles. Restrict permissions to the minimum required.
  3. Short-Lived Credentials: Replace static passwords with temporary credentials from AWS Secrets Manager or IAM database authentication.
  4. Audit Logging: Enable CloudTrail and enhanced database logs. Periodically review them for anomalies.
  5. Incident Response Steps: Include exact commands and AWS Console paths for revoking access instantly.
  6. Review and Rotation Schedule: Set recurring reviews for all users and rotate credentials automatically.

Making It Work Without Engineering Bottlenecks

Runbooks are only useful if they can be followed without deep AWS expertise. Use plain steps, screenshots, and tested commands. Pair them with automation so that approvals trigger pre-built scripts. That way, processes are followed the same way every time — fast and without mistakes.
